What unit did you put in for? You should have your tag mailed back by mid september. Aug 6th was the date for the first round of "unsold" license. WHich means most residents and non residents have already sent in for their first doe tag. You get whats left over. Here is an update on what units still have tags. https://www2.pa.wildlifelicense.com/deeravail.php

If you go here https://www1.pa.wildlifelicense.com/start.php
click on the first dot which gives you the ability to check the status of your application. Follow the prompts, enter your CID # when asked and you can see if the permit has been awarded. |

Check the DMAP stuff. There are some good areas left with tags. State Parks, State Forests, some others. Usually the private farms are worthless that are listed. Some of the DMAP areas straddle more than one Management Area and are pretty good the second week.
